If you are having difficulty signing into iFile/iReg
- Make sure you are registered with the VEC. A properly registered account with the VEC has a 10-digit account number (00######## or 000#######)
- If you have a temporary access number (F#########), use it along with your VEC Username and VEC Password to log in to iFile.
- Make sure you are using your VEC Account Number, VEC Username and VEC Password
- Your enrollment in Business iFile/iReg may have expired. Re-enroll here for the VEC ONLY
- Email the VEC at ifileVEC@vec.virginia.gov or call (804) 786-1082

Virginia Relay enables people who are deaf, hard of hearing, Deaf/Blind, or speech disabled to communicate by TTY (text telephone). Individuals who need this service can access the Virginia Relay Center by dialing 711 or (800) 828-1140.
